1. Monthly Payment (EMI) Formula

Your monthly payment is calculated using a standardized formula to ensure consistency over the loan term.

M = P [ i(1 + i)^n ] / [ (1 + i)^n – 1 ]

  • M = Total monthly payment.
  • P = The principal loan amount.
  • i = Your monthly interest rate (annual rate divided by 12).
  • n = The total number of payments (loan term in years multiplied by 12).

2. Equity Calculation Formula

Your equity represents your ownership stake in the property. It grows as you pay down your loan and as the property value appreciates.

Equity = Property Value – Remaining Loan Balance

  • Property Value = The current market value of your home.
  • Remaining Loan Balance = The outstanding amount you still owe on your mortgage.

The Formula Behind Your Investment Growth

Understanding how your money grows is the first step towards financial empowerment. Our calculator uses the standard compound interest formula to project your earnings. This formula is the cornerstone of many investments, including term deposits.

A = P (1 + r/n)nt

  • A = The future value of the investment, or the maturity amount.
  • P = The principal amount (your initial deposit).
  • r = The annual interest rate (in decimal form, e.g., 5% becomes 0.05).
  • n = The number of times interest is compounded per year.
  • t = The tenure of the investment in years.

Detailed Formula Explanation

The compound interest formula, A = P (1 + r/n)nt, might seem complex, but it’s a powerful tool. Let’s break it down. ‘P’ is your starting principal. The part in the parenthesis, (1 + r/n), calculates the growth factor for a single compounding period. ‘r/n’ divides the annual rate by the number of times it’s compounded. This factor is then raised to the power of ‘nt’—the total number of compounding periods over the entire investment tenure. This exponentiation is what creates the “compounding” effect, where your interest starts earning its own interest, leading to exponential growth over time.

What is a term deposit?

A term deposit, often called a fixed deposit (FD), is a type of savings account where you deposit a lump sum of money for a fixed period (tenure) at a predetermined interest rate. The interest rate is typically higher than a regular savings account, but you cannot withdraw the money before the tenure ends without incurring a penalty.

What does ‘compounding frequency’ mean?

Compounding frequency is how often the interest earned is calculated and added to your principal amount. The new, larger principal then earns interest in the next period. More frequent compounding (e.g., monthly) results in slightly higher returns than less frequent compounding (e.g., annually) for the same annual interest rate.

Deep Dive into the Loan Formula

The amortization formula is powerful because it ensures that each fixed monthly payment you make covers both the interest accrued for that month and a portion of the principal loan amount. In the beginning of your loan term, a larger portion of your payment goes towards interest. As you continue to make payments and your principal balance decreases, less interest accrues each month. Consequently, a larger portion of your payment starts going towards paying down the principal. Our line and bar charts above beautifully visualize this transition, showing your equity growing faster towards the end of the loan term.

M = P [r(1+r)ⁿ] / [(1+r)ⁿ – 1]

This elegant mathematical structure is the backbone of all installment loans, from auto financing to mortgages, providing a predictable and stable repayment schedule for both the borrower and the lender.

The Formula We Use

To provide an accurate estimate, our calculator uses a standard industry formula:

1. Calculate Total Surface Area:

Total Area = (Total Wall Width × Wall Height)

2. Subtract Non-Paintable Areas:

Paintable Area = Total Area - (Number of Doors × 20 sq ft) - (Number of Windows × 15 sq ft)

3. Determine Total Paint Needed:

Gallons Needed = (Paintable Area / 350 sq ft per gallon) × Number of Coats

Note: We assume a standard door is 20 sq. ft., a standard window is 15 sq. ft., and one gallon of paint covers approximately 350 sq. ft. The final result is rounded up to the nearest whole number.

Understanding the Land Loan Formula

The calculation for your loan payments might seem complex, but it’s based on a standard financial formula that ensures a fixed monthly payment over the life of the loan. This formula methodically accounts for both the principal (the amount you borrowed) and the interest that accrues over time.

M = P [ r(1+r)^n ] / [ (1+r)^n – 1]

  • P (Principal): This is the starting point—the total amount of money you borrow to purchase the land.
  • r (Monthly Interest Rate): The calculator takes the annual interest rate you provide and divides it by 12 to get the monthly rate. This is crucial because interest compounds monthly, not annually.
  • n (Number of Payments): This represents the total number of months you will be making payments. The calculator converts the loan term from years into months (e.g., a 20-year loan has 240 payment periods).

The formula’s numerator, r(1+r)^n, determines the compounding effect of interest over the loan’s lifetime. The denominator, (1+r)^n – 1, helps amortize, or spread out, these payments evenly. By balancing these factors, the formula generates a consistent monthly payment, ensuring the loan is fully paid off by the end of the term.

Q1: What is the difference between a land loan and a regular home loan?
A1: Land loans are typically considered riskier by lenders because there is no house on the property to act as collateral. As a result, they often require a larger down payment (e.g., 20-50%) and may have higher interest rates and shorter repayment terms compared to traditional mortgages.

Q1: What is amortization?

Amortization refers to the process of spreading out a loan into a series of fixed payments over time. Each payment consists of both principal and interest. While the payment amount remains the same, the portion of principal and interest in each payment changes over the life of the loan.

Q2: Why does more of my early payment go towards interest?

In the beginning of a loan, the principal balance is at its highest. Since interest is calculated based on the outstanding balance, the interest portion of your payment is largest at the start. As you pay down the principal, the interest due each month decreases, and a larger portion of your fixed payment goes towards reducing the principal.

Q3: How can I use this schedule to pay off my loan faster?

You can use the schedule to see the impact of making extra payments. Any payment you make that is above your required monthly amount will typically go directly towards the principal balance. This reduces the outstanding loan amount, which in turn reduces the amount of future interest you’ll pay, and shortens the loan term.

The Power of Compounding

This calculator uses the future value formula for a series with regular contributions:

A = P(1 + r/n)ⁿᵗ + PMT × [((1 + r/n)ⁿᵗ - 1) / (r/n)]

Understanding the Formula

The growth of your savings is calculated using the formula for the future value of a series, which accounts for both your initial lump sum and your ongoing periodic contributions. It’s a combination of two powerful financial concepts:

  1. Compound Interest on Initial Principal: The first part, P(1 + r/n)ⁿᵗ, calculates the future value of your initial investment (P) as it compounds over time.
  2. Future Value of Contributions: The second part, PMT × [((1 + r/n)ⁿᵗ - 1) / (r/n)], calculates the future value of your series of regular monthly payments (PMT). Each payment has time to grow, and this formula sums up the future value of all of them.

By adding these two results together, we get the total future value of your investment, accurately reflecting how both your initial capital and your consistent savings efforts contribute to your wealth.

Q: What is compound interest?

A: Compound interest is “interest on interest.” It is the process where the interest you earn on your savings or investment is added back to the principal amount. In the next period, you earn interest on this new, larger principal. This causes your wealth to grow at an accelerating rate over time.

Q: Does this calculator account for inflation or taxes?

A: No, this calculator does not factor in inflation or taxes on interest earnings. The results show the nominal future value. To understand your real return, you would need to subtract the expected inflation rate from your interest rate and account for any applicable taxes separately.
